Understanding the Core Mechanics

At the heart of most crazy tower games lies a fundamental set of mechanics centered around precision and timing. Players typically control a device, such as a crane, a platform, or a launching mechanism, that manipulates blocks or objects to construct a tower. The core challenge isn’t just in placing the blocks, but in doing so accurately and stably. Factors like wind, gravity, and the shape of the blocks all contribute to the difficulty. Successful play demands an intuitive understanding of these forces and the ability to compensate for them.

The Evolution of Tower Building Games

The concept of building towers in games has evolved considerably over time. Earlier arcade games utilized simple 2D graphics and straightforward mechanics. However, as technology advanced, developers began to incorporate more sophisticated graphics, physics engines, and gameplay elements. 3D environments added a new dimension to the challenge, requiring players to consider depth perception and spatial awareness. This evolution has led to a diverse range of tower-building games, each with its own unique twists and challenges.
